    Hi Iconoclastmac,

    Please try unistalling Adobe Reader and system cleaning by the following steps:

    1. go to/Applications/Adobe Reader.app. Drag and drop this app in the trash.

    2. go to the Internet plug-ins present in the System/Library/Internet Plug-Ins library - / and put the following in the Trash:

    (a) / Library/Internet Plug-Ins/AdobePDFViewer.plugin

    (b) / Library/Internet Plug-Ins/AdobePDFViewerNPAPI.plugin

    3. go to/Library/Application Support / Adobe and move the following files to the Trash:

    (a) / Library/Application Support/Adobe/Reader

    (b) / Library/Application Support/Adobe/HelpCfg

    4. go to /Library/Preferences/com.adobe.acrobat.pdfviewer.plist and place this plist in the trash.

    Restart your Mac.Try install Adobe Reader ftp://ftp.adobe.com/pub/adobe/reader/mac/11.x/11.0.09/en_US/AdbeRdr11009_en_US.dmg 11.0.09

  • CS6 Adobe Bridge does not open

    I intalled PS CS6 yesterday to see that Btidge does not open. I have looked for answers since then and have not yet found any. I reinstalled just to see if it would make a difference, but it didn't. I'm currently under Windows 7 64-bit. Photoshop runs great, the only problem is with the bridge, and apparently I can't get any help from Adobe until tomorrow

    Thank you mjw5997 for sending me the dmp file! We checked and found that it is a bug in code Brige.

    This launch issue occurs when you install Bridge CS6 on a machine with installed CS2 bridge.

    We can repair, but I don't know when the fix can be published. [Currently we have workaround: create an empty folder in C:\Users\[your username] \AppData\Roaming\Adobe\.
